Product Name: Valve Rod
Model Number: 57.3mm * 4.3mm, -1,0, + I, II
Brand: United Diesel, in Sina
Condition: Brand New
Application: DENSO Injector 095000-1654
Product Name: Valve Rod
Model Number: 57.3mm * 4.3mm, -1,0, + I, II
Brand: United Diesel, in Sina
Condition: Brand New
Application: DENSO Injector 095000-1654